This is the category a woman in Shunem in the days of Elisha belonged to. She had a problem that money could not solve. She must have spent money to tackle this problem but to no avail. Perhaps, she had prayed too but answers were not in view. What was the problem? She had no child. But she did that which provoked her answers. Perhaps this secret could hold the answer to your situation this season.

Prophet Elisha regularly visited a small town called Shunem for the work of God. He usually depended on God who called him to feed and to house him. One day a woman approached her husband and proposed that they make him (Elisha) a room so that he can stay. She expanded her house to ensure that the man of God could dwell. She ensured that it was filled with everything that the man of God would need. This woman’s desire to have the man of God resident in her house put an end to the reproach of her life.
